Almost any type of wood can be reproduced with a wood-graining technique. From an aged oak door, with faux moulding and old wood pegs using 'trompe-l'oeil' to a birdseye maple panel with 'trompe-l'oeil' bamboo ornamentation or burl walnut. |
 |
 |
Faux wood does not always immitate real wood, like maple or oak. This is a "fantasy" wood, created in yellow ochre and olive green to match an already installed kitchen decor. |
